#534940 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#534940 is composed of 32.5% red, 28.6%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 28.4 degrees, a saturation of 12.9% and a lightness of 28.8%. #534940 color hex could be obtained by blending #a69280 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#534940 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#534940 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#534940 has RGB values of R:83, G:73,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.23,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5458240.
